Hydrolytic and radiolytic degradation of O/phi/D (iB)CMPO; continuing studies

The hydrolytic and radiolytic degradation of octyl(phenyl)-N,N-diisobutylcarbamoyl-methylphosphine oxide (CMPO) in tetrachloroethylene (TCE) and in tributylphosphate-TCE mixtures (TRUEX process solvent) in contact with HNO/sub 3/ has been investigated. Gas chromatographic analysis of the degraded solutions has allowed identification and quantitation of a variety of organophosphorus degradation compounds derived from CMPO. The effect of degradation of the extractant solutions on the extraction and stripping of americium has been addressed, as has the effectiveness of Na/sub 2/CO/sub 3/ scrub procedures for restoring extractant performance. Extrapolation of these results to normal process application conditions indicates that neither hydrolysis nor radiolysis should compromise the americium extraction performance of TRUEX-TCE.
